Job description

Location: Oklahoma City, OK - On-site, 5 days per week
Compensation: $90,000–$100,000 plus 100% paid benefits for employee, PTO, 401K match
Position Type: Direct Hire - Candidates must be authorized to work in the United States now and in the future without sponsorship assistance.

We are partnering with a growing industrial manufacturing client in Oklahoma City that is looking to add a few Product Engineers to their engineering team. These positions will support the design, application, and manufacturing of industrial flow-control products used in oil & gas, refinery, and industrial processing environments.

This is an excellent opportunity for engineers who enjoy a combination of technical engineering, product application support, and hands-on collaboration with manufacturing and sales teams. The engineers will join a close-knit team environment and work directly with production, quality, supply chain, and customer-facing teams to support highly engineered industrial products.

Key Responsibilities
  • Support the design, application, and manufacturing of industrial valve and flow-control products
  • Work closely with sales and customer service teams to provide technical recommendations and product selection support
  • Size valves and develop flow calculations using API 520 or ANSI/ISA S75.01 standards
  • Prepare technical data sheets, product drawings, bills of materials, and customer-facing engineering documentation
  • Create and manage engineering change requests (ECRs) and engineering change notices (ECNs)
  • Support manufacturing, quality, assembly, and supply chain teams with troubleshooting and technical guidance
  • Develop and maintain build/test procedures and engineering documentation
  • Collaborate with engineering teams on product improvements, problem solving, and sustaining engineering initiativesJa
  • Utilize SolidWorks, AutoCAD, and ERP/MRP systems to support product development and manufacturing activities
Required Qualifications
  • Mechanical Engineering Degree (BSME)
  • Application/Design aptitude of Safety Relief Vales and/or Chokes
  • Experience with Sizing (flows) API 520 or ANSI/ISA S75.01
  • Strong knowledge/familiarity in ASME Sec XIII and API 6A
  • Primary drafting experience using SolidWorks (AutoCAD application also preferred)
